Transaction d7652c8516e90458330f7b554ba69852dde4c20598cbcad598a458a1e8487934
1 Input
2 Outputs
- d7652c8516e90458330f7b554ba69852dde4c20598cbcad598a458a1e8487934:0
- d7652c8516e90458330f7b554ba69852dde4c20598cbcad598a458a1e8487934:1
value 1000000
address 1Z2KrTtkHzPL2oX2axkDqQcSvr8tXxQJ9
value 288202249
address 12ArYYogqnw8TDDiixFEemrKSjpLsk42V6